Discovering new flavors at Tucson’s top restaurants:

One of the best places to start your culinary tour of Tucson is at El Charro Cafe, which is said to be the oldest Mexican restaurant in the United States. This historic restaurant has been serving traditional Mexican dishes since 1922 and is known for its delicious carne seca, a dried beef dish that is a specialty of the restaurant. Visitors can also enjoy a margarita at the restaurant’s cantina, which is said to be the birthplace of the margarita.

A guide to Tucson’s most popular cuisine:

For an authentic taste of southwestern cuisine, visitors should head to Café Poca Cosa. This popular restaurant is known for its rotating menu, which features a variety of dishes that are inspired by the flavors of Mexico, New Mexico, and Arizona. The menu changes daily, so visitors can enjoy a different culinary experience each time they visit. Some of the most popular dishes include the mole negro and the tamales. Another popular destination for southwestern cuisine is the El Guero Canelo. This casual restaurant is known for its delicious Sonoran-style hot dogs, which are wrapped in bacon and topped with a variety of toppings, such as beans, mayo, and salsa.

Tucson’s Food Festivals and Markets:

Tucson is home to a variety of food festivals and markets throughout the year, offering visitors the chance to sample a wide range of flavors and cuisines. One of the most popular food festivals in the city is the Tucson Tamal and Heritage Festival. This festival is held annually in November, and features a wide variety of tamales from different vendors, as well as other traditional Mexican dishes, live music, and cultural performances.

Another popular food festival in Tucson is the Arizona Wine Festival. This festival is held annually in March, and features a wide variety of wines from Arizona wineries, as well as food from local restaurants and vendors. Visitors can sample a wide range of wines and enjoy live music and other entertainment.

The Tucson Food Truck Round Up is a monthly event held in various locations around the city, it features a wide variety of food trucks, live music and vendors. It’s a great opportunity to try different foods in one place and also to discover new food trucks.
